在创建模式时,liquibase默认使用双引号来引用关键字。然而,如果需要使用反引号来引用关键字,liquibase也提供了相应的方法。
要让liquibase使用反引号而不是双引号来引用关键字,可以在数据库变更脚本中使用"quoteIdentifiers"属性。该属性可以设置为"true",以告诉liquibase使用反引号进行引用。
下面是一个示例的数据库变更脚本:
--liquibase formatted sql
--changeset author:你的名字
CREATE TABLE `my_table` (
`id` INT PRIMARY KEY,
`name` VARCHAR(255)
);
--rollback DROP TABLE `my_table`;
在这个示例中,关键字"my_table"和"id"被使用了反引号进行引用。
对于liquibase使用反引号来引用关键字的优势是可以避免与数据库关键字冲突的问题,以及增加脚本的可移植性。
liquibase是一款开源的数据库变更管理工具,它可以帮助开发人员更好地管理数据库变更。腾讯云的相关产品中,云数据库MySQL和云数据库MariaDB都支持使用liquibase进行数据库变更管理。
请注意,以上所提到的云计算品牌商仅作为参考,答案中并没有直接提及。
领取专属 10元无门槛券
手把手带您无忧上云